技术文摘
阿里技术精英:架构师的进阶路线图!
阿里技术精英:架构师的进阶路线图!
在当今数字化时代,架构师成为了技术领域中备受瞩目的角色。对于众多技术从业者来说,成为一名优秀的架构师是他们追求的职业目标。而在阿里这样的科技巨头中,技术精英们积累了丰富的经验,为我们绘制出了一条清晰的架构师进阶路线图。
扎实的基础知识是架构师成长的基石。精通编程语言、数据结构、算法等核心知识是必不可少的。这就如同建筑的根基,只有根基稳固,才能支撑起高楼大厦。不断深入学习和实践,通过实际项目中的运用,将理论知识转化为实际能力。
具备系统设计能力是关键的一步。能够从宏观的角度去理解整个系统的架构,包括业务流程、技术选型、模块划分等。这需要对业务有深刻的理解,能够将业务需求转化为技术实现。要关注系统的可扩展性、性能、安全性等方面,确保系统能够应对未来的业务增长和变化。
然后,积累丰富的项目经验是提升的重要途径。参与不同类型、规模的项目,从中汲取经验教训。在项目中,学会解决各种技术难题,与团队成员有效协作,提升自己的沟通和协调能力。通过项目的历练,不断完善自己的架构设计思路和方法。
持续学习和跟进技术前沿也是架构师的必备素养。技术在不断发展和更新,新的框架、工具、理念层出不穷。架构师要保持敏锐的技术洞察力,及时学习和引入适合的新技术,为系统的优化和创新提供支持。
培养全局视野和战略思维能够让架构师站在更高的层面看待问题。不仅关注技术层面,还要考虑业务战略、市场趋势等因素对系统架构的影响。能够从公司的整体发展角度出发,为系统的长期发展制定规划。
最后,良好的团队合作和领导力也是架构师走向成功的重要因素。能够引领团队朝着共同的目标前进,激发团队成员的创造力和潜力,打造高效、协作的技术团队。
成为一名优秀的架构师并非一蹴而就,需要沿着这条清晰的进阶路线图,不断努力和积累。借鉴阿里技术精英们的经验,我们可以在架构师的道路上走得更加稳健,为技术领域的发展贡献自己的力量。
- Python主线程的相关应用方法
- python多线程应用详解
- Python django应用五大关键步骤
- Python编程语言和Ruby的比较
- Python正则表达式简单介绍
- OSGi有望火爆,IBM与Eclipse力推Java模块化
- VB6实现MUI程序的详细方法
- Visual Studio 2010助力敏捷开发与云计算落地
- Python线程编程主要表达方式详细解析
- Python字符串操作的五种具体方法
- Python运算符的两种应用方案详细解析
- Python函数参数传递方法的详细介绍
- Scala简史:对象函数式编程
- Python与Java编程语言的技术对比
- Python函数式与Ruby相关技术对比